Output 8095c28cbd9e7385564e6d7a5442e88c01be5952de2cb39211bac5ebaf0d64c6:1

value
30890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2289cfdcb74c5d64bcad3185c043f0d571a5634 OP_EQUAL
address
3KPdfcj4gzhR9vPA5jhYuMGWcAGz6CBhCU
transaction
8095c28cbd9e7385564e6d7a5442e88c01be5952de2cb39211bac5ebaf0d64c6
confirmations
211866
spent
true